SYNOPSIS
Creation Formula is documentary about the Armenian composer and piano performer Arno Babajanyan, a People’s Artist of USSR and Armenia. “Whatever I compose has an Armenian soul”: the talented artist symbolicly confessed. His creative and performing career lasted for about half a century and from the begining attracted the attention of the art society. The film is not biographical even though the director has tried to represent the composer’s stories with a humorous approach.

Nikolay Davtyan
Born 1953, Yerevan, Armenia. Davtyan studied film directing in the Department of Culture of Yerevan State Pedagogical Institute named after Khachatur Abovyan. Since 1969 he worked for TV companies in Yerevan, Moscow, Yekaterinburg, Stepanakert and also at state institutions of Armenia. Davtyan participated in numerous USSR and international festivals and competitions. His films have been rewarded with a number of awards.
Filmography
The Sinner (1982), In Merry Gyumri (1983), They Say that… (1989, TV film), Right to Be Called a Human Being (1998), Feast of Harvest (2000), The Refugee (2001), Yerevan-Baku (2002), Uncle Valya (2010), Creation Formula (2013).
